One of the most important factors that affect the hardness of formed products is forming tool design( drawing die profile). Die profile shape with other factors like reduction of area, forming temperature , friction... etc. Will produce a specific deformation mode that characterizes deformed metal by drawing process. This will have a direct effect on hardness of the drawn product .This was carried out by studying the final mechanical properties of the drawn products through dies with theoretical concepts(UCRHS, ACRHS , DCRHS , CMSR) and other with industrial concepts taper die ( = )
All at fixed reduction in area of 64% .
The material used in this research is commercial pure copper . the drawing process was carried out at room temperature.
Obtained results show that drawing die( CMSR) is the most efficient die design, at the same time, design of taper die ( = ) shows the lowest efficiency as compared with others.
